<p> Meet Mr. Shakespeare Research Model: Creative Project/Presentation Planning Sheet</p><p>Topic: Shakespeare’s Theater Due Date: ______</p><p>Group Members: </p><p>Project/Presentation Ideas: Please note that all projects include written work, and must be accompanied by a Works Cited list for the group. 1. Create a model of one or more of Shakespeare’s theaters, including labels and captions. 2. Create a diagram of one or more of Shakespeare’s theaters, including labels and captions. 3. Create a brochure describing Shakespeare’s theaters, including text and images; you may want to use Microsoft Publisher. 4. Create a virtual tour of one or more of Shakespeare’s theaters, including text and images; you may want to use Microsoft PowerPoint or Microsoft FrontPage. 5. Create an Oral Report with Visuals (poster, collage, original artwork, digital images displayed on screen, etc.) 6. Your group’s own proposal for a creative project/presentation:</p><p>Project/Presentation Plan: Decide what needs to be done to prepare and present your project, and how you will divide the work so that each member contributes equally. Materials/equipment needed to create or present your group project (art supplies, computer, data projector, video camera, photocopier to make handouts for the class, etc.):</p><p>Group Member Tasks  Group Works Cited list </p>
